Homemade Fruit Snacks
There's nothing artificial or processed in these homemade fruit snacks - just fresh fruit, a little fruit juice, a splash of maple syrup for sweetness and unflavored gelatin.
Ingredients
- 2 ยฝ cups fresh or frozen fruit
- โ cup orange juice
- 3 tablespoons pure maple syrup or honey
- 5 tablespoons unflavored gelatin
Instructions
- Prepare 8-inch baking dish* by lining with parchment paper (for easy removal). In medium saucepan, add fruit, orange juice and maple syrup. Cook over medium-low heat, just to soften fruit. Turn off heat and carefully pour mixture into blender or food processor. Puree until smooth.
- Pour mixture back into saucepan. Turn heat to low and slowly add gelatin. Continue to whisk until gelatin is completely dissolved and no clumps remain. Pour into prepared pan. Place in refrigerator for about 1-2 hours, until set. Remove from pan and cut into ยฝ-inch squares (a pizza cutter works great!). Store in air-tight container. These fruit snacks to not have to be refrigerated, but we prefer to keep them chilled.
